Former LG Service Commissioner, Pa Ogbe Dies At 88

Kunle Adelabu Pa Samuel Falabake Ogbe, the head of the Odujumo – Araba family of Ikorodu and former Commissioner 2 in the Local Government Service Commission, is dead. The late Pa Ogbe was also the head of the Church of the Lord Aladura in Ipakodo – Ebute. The senior legal practitioner, who died on Saturday (yesterday) at the General Hospital, Ikorodu, was 88 years. He was an active community and students’ activist in his days. Sen. Abiru New Blocks Of Classrooms At Aga Pry School Nearing Completion

Kunle Adelabu -500 students to benefit from his bursary award soon Contractor handling the construction of the massive blocks of classrooms at the Aga Primary School, Aga, in Ikorodu Local Government, facilitated by the Senator representing the Lagos East Senatorial District, Sen. Tokunbo Abiru, is doing everything to deliver the project on schedule time. The construction of the 4 blocks of 24 Classrooms with toilets is a project scheduled for completion within a month.
